Republican U.S. Senator Bob Bennett of Utah won't be in the race to serve a fourth term for the GOP. Attorney Mike Lee and businessman Tim Bridgewater beat out Bennett during the GOP state convention on Saturday. The senator becomes this year’s first incumbent to lose his seat in Washington, possibly falling victim to Tea Party activists. The conservative movement targeted Bennett for his part in raising taxes and what they perceived as the growth of the government. Bennett's support of the massive financial industry bailout, earmarks, and participation in co-sponsoring a bipartisan bill to mandate health insurance coverage may well have been his downfall.
